Gaining the competitive advantage:

One way to become the leading motorcycle company is to research customers and to feed their needs. Assuring customers of a quality  product is only part of the story. Building a community of customers is key to continued success. How do you describe a motorcycle customer?  The stereotype of the gang style biker gives a misleading impression and this is only a tiny part of the picture - people of all ages, backgrounds, and varying interests make up the client base for this thriving market.

At the Grand Opening of the Harley-Davidson Cafe,  Las Vegas on the evening of September 23, 1997,  more than 1500 guests attended the celebration including: Burt Reynolds, Carrot Top, Stephanie Powers, Downtown Julie Brown, Donna D'Erico, Pamela Anderson Lee, and John Voight.

Celebrity spokespersons sometimes show support for a favoured product or service.  In this case, these stars came out to enjoy an evening in one of the two Harley-Davidson cafes (the other is in New York City.
